From 32b23bfb08138a8010dadd7b568d3aad40c17284 Mon Sep 17 00:00:00 2001 From: liuhao1024 Date: Wed, 1 Jul 2026 14:11:40 +0530 Subject: [PATCH] fix(compressor): strip orphan tool_calls instead of inserting stubs (#51218) _sanitize_tool_pairs inserted stub role="tool" results for orphaned tool_calls. The pre-API repair_message_sequence() tracks known call IDs by tc.get("id") while this sanitizer keys on call_id||id; when they disagree (Codex Responses API: id != call_id) the stubs are silently dropped by the repair pass, re-exposing the original orphans. Strip the orphaned tool_calls at the source instead (preserving any text content, adding a placeholder for an otherwise-empty assistant turn) to avoid the mismatch class entirely.
